    When I just can't stand it anymore, I tend to buy neutrals. I am so drawn to them and after deciding that the next quilt I make will be scrappy, you can never have enough neutrals!! I have heard that at many seminars and from scrap quilters. However, I find that I also need white on whites, but in smaller quantities than the neutrals.
